package koala
KoalaNLP
통합 Scala 한국어 분석기, Koala
각 Package의 Parser와 Tagger를 참조하세요.
Linear Supertypes
Ordering
- Alphabetic
- By Inheritance
Inherited
- koala
- AnyRef
- Any
- Hide All
- Show All
Visibility
- Public
- All
Type Members
-
implicit
class
KoreanCharacterExtension
extends AnyRef
한국어를 구성하는 문자의 연산.
-
implicit
class
KoreanStringExtension
extends AnyRef
한국어를 구성하는 문자열의 연산.
Value Members
- final val ALPHABET_READING: Seq[(Char, String)]
-
final
val
HANGUL_END: Int
'힣' 위치 *
-
final
val
HANGUL_START: Int
'가' 위치 *
-
final
val
JONGSUNG_RANGE: Int
종성 범위 *
-
final
val
JUNGSUNG_RANGE: Int
중성 범위 *
-
final
def
isAlphabetPronounced(word: String): Boolean
발음나는대로 표기된 알파벳인지 확인.
발음나는대로 표기된 알파벳인지 확인.
- word
확인할 단어.
- returns
True: 단어 전체가 발음나는대로 표기된 경우.
- Annotations
- @tailrec()
-
final
def
pronounceAlphabet(x: String, acc: String = ""): String
알파벳 발음나는 대로 국문표기
알파벳 발음나는 대로 국문표기
- x
변환할 문자열.
- acc
(누적변수)
- returns
변환한 문자열
- Annotations
- @tailrec()
-
def
reconstructKorean(cho: Int = 11, jung: Int = 0, jong: Int = 0): Char
한글 문자 재구성
한글 문자 재구성
- cho
초성 위치
- jung
중성 위치
- jong
종성 위치
- returns
조합된 문자
-
final
def
writeAlphabet(x: String, acc: String = ""): String
알파벳 발음을 알파벳으로 변환
알파벳 발음을 알파벳으로 변환
- x
변환할 문자열.
- acc
(누적변수)
- returns
변환된 문자열.
- Annotations
- @tailrec()
-
object
FunctionalTag
extends Enumeration
의존구문분석 표기의 종류.
-
object
Implicit
Object for implicit conversions.
-
object
POS
extends Enumeration
통합 품사 표기